About the role

The Forklift Operator - Receiving position is available for a second shift from 1 PM to 9 PM, with additional hours until 11 PM on Saturdays. The wage is $20.31 per hour plus a $1.50 shift differential.

Responsibilities

  • Operate Dock Stocker and High Reach forklifts to safely unload shipments and transport products to designated warehouse storage areas.
  • Complete orders efficiently by processing pick tickets, performing full pallet picking, and shuttling pallets for final order processing using scanners and computers.
  • Interact with management software systems and label printers; read work orders or receive instructions to determine assignments and material needs.
  • Perform physical activities requiring lifting, balancing, walking, stooping, and safe handling of materials.
  • Maintain a clean, debris-free, and safe work area at all times.
  • Support cross-training in other distribution center functions and perform other duties assigned.

Requirements

  • A high school diploma or GED equivalent.
  • 1-2 years of forklift operation experience in a warehouse or distribution environment.
  • Ability to obtain forklift operator certification.
  • Broad knowledge of distribution center methods and procedures.
  • Familiarity with product catalog numbers and handling characteristics.
  • Knowledge of safety regulations and procedures related to forklift operations.
  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to accuracy.
  • Excellent communication and teamwork skills.
  • Physical ability to regularly stand, walk, reach, stoop, kneel, crouch, use hands, and lift/move up to 50 lbs.
  • Resilience to work in environments with extreme temperatures.
  • Ability to work in a scanner-directed job and operate a stand-up forklift for the entire shift.
